[Pkg-javascript-devel] Bug#988884: libsass and node-node-sass is deprecated upstream

Nilesh Patra nilesh at nileshpatra.info
Thu May 20 19:52:56 BST 2021



On 5/21/21 12:12 AM, Pirate Praveen wrote:
> Package: libsass, node-node-sass
> Severity: important
> 
> libsass and node-sass seems deprecated by upstream in favor of dart sass.
> 
> https://sass-lang.com/blog/libsass-is-deprecated

The README for node-sass(src:node-node-sass) also seems to say the same[1]

> I was trying to package rollup-plugin-sass and noticed it is using sass module and not node-sass module.
> 
> I tried a simple patch to replace sass with node-sass in rollup-plugin-sass, but build was failing when trying to bundle it.> I will try packaging dart-sass, but I have never touched a package written in dart yet.

Dart isn't packaged for Debian yet, and iirc there are a lot of pre-conditions for this (and probably a plan too?)
At present, it'd probably be possible to only package the javascript API[2] and it may or may not be compatible.

Thanks a lot for reporting this bug! 

[1]: https://github.com/sass/node-sass#readme
[2]: https://github.com/sass/dart-sass#javascript-api

Nilesh

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: OpenPGP digital signature
URL: <http://alioth-lists.debian.net/pipermail/pkg-javascript-devel/attachments/20210521/9a6db0ae/attachment.sig>


More information about the Pkg-javascript-devel mailing list